Briefly describe three questions you should ask yourself when judging the accuracy of a speaker's
conclusions.
What will be an ideal response?
(1 ) Is the speaker qualified to draw the conclusion? (2 ) Has the speaker actually observed the concept or issue about which he or she is talking? (3 ) Does the speaker have a vested interest in the message?
